Remaining slipcase update:

Eliminators - 579 / 1000
Luther the Geek - 243 / 500
Bride From Hell - 228 / 500
Django Kill - 236 / 500
The Flying Guillotine - 172 / 500
Mountaintop Motel Massacre - 137 / 999
Cold Blooded Beast - 96 / 500
Body Puzzle - 75 / 500
The Oily Maniac - 44 / 500
The Perfume of the Lady in Black - 37 / 500
Bewitched - 148 / 400
The House on Sorority Row - 614 / 1000
Watch Me When I Kill - 245 / 500
In the Eye of the Hurricane - 440 / 500
Happy Hell Night - Sold Out
Zombie Creeping flesh - Sold Out
